So my first week or two on phen, i lost 10 lbs and went from 205 to 195. I then kept working out and ate well for a couple days and it never changed. Then I went to Kentucky for about 5 days and wasn't able to work out and I couldn't eat very healthy though I did cut down on my portions which I was proud of, but I still took phen. I got back on monday and weighed in at about 199 lbs. by wed i was back to 195 lbs by getting back to my exercise and eating routine. I've been doing really well on working out (im doing the 30 day shred) and eating well but i'm still at 195 lbs! I can't figure out why! I feel like I'm doing everything right but it's just not lowering. I have about 3 meals a day and a desert (jenny craig desert so its not high in calories or anything like that) and I eat jenny craig breakfast and sometimes lunch and dinner. Does anyone have any advice! I wanted to be down 30 lbs by aug 18 but at this rate that is not going to happen. PLEASE HELP!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!

Lot's of things could be going on here...your body coulb be adjusting to the new lifestyle, sometimes it takes time for your body to believe you mean it this time! Your body has a "comfortable weight" and until you stick to a good plan for a while, it might be fighting to go back. Also, you could be gaining muscle. A pound of fat is larger in size than a pound of muscle. So if you are swapping muscle for fat, you won't see the numbers going down, but you will see your size go down. Try taking your measurements once a week. Also, are you counting calories? Many people who do not count calories may not realize what all the food you eat adds up to. Also, frozen diet meals tend to have massive amounts of salt, which is not good for you at all, and can make you retain water. You might want to try switching to chicken breast and steamed veggies. It can be super quick to make. And if you were 199 on Monday...today is only Thursday, so at 196 you already have a 4 pound loss this week..is that right? I would say that's nothing to complain about! You can't rush this, especially at your weight. The huge numbers you see people dropping are usually when they start off way heavier than you, so it's much easier for them to drop large numbers at first.

I did Jenny Craig and it worked well for a while, but went off it, went back and could barely budge a pound. It's way too expensive for the results you get. Now I'm going to a nutritionist at a diet clinic, and in addition to the Phentermine they have given me a diet which I've found pretty easy to follow. I'm allowed two low-glycemic (like blueberries, strawberries, apples, and cantaloupe) fruit servings a day, one low fat dairy (try the Chobani Greek Yogurt!), unlimited non-starchy veggies, and have been told to get 80-100 grams of protein a day from chicken, turkey, seafood, bison (?), cottage cheese and eggs (one with a yolk and unlimited egg whites). I can also have up to 40 calories of salad dressing. They also have great protein bars that are totally yummy (Google Bariatric Protein Bars). So, this being my first week, we went to the beach for three days last weekend, and based on my home scale looks like I've lost 5 pounds already! I weigh in officially tomorrow. I haven't found it to be too bad... and it's not nearly as expensive as Jenny. When you go out to eat, eliminate the bread, fries, potatoes, etc and get salads, extra veggies, veggie soup, etc. You'll find that with the phen, you aren't hungry for that stuff anyways.
